What Is Design/Build?

Traditional building often follows a “design-bid-build” approach: a designer creates plans, contractors bid the job, and then construction begins, sometimes with gaps between what was designed and what can realistically be built within budget.

Design/build simplifies this by combining planning and execution under one roof. At Liberty, that means:

1. Planning decisions are made with real construction knowledge from day one

2. Budgets and timelines are considered while design choices are being made

3. Material and structural decisions are coordinated, not guessed at

4. Fewer delays and fewer “surprises” caused by misaligned teams

5. A smoother workflow with clear responsibility and communication

In short: design/build creates alignment. And alignment reduces stress. 

Why Choose Design/Build?

Design/build is a strong option for clients who value clarity, speed, and a more predictable build experience. It’s especially helpful when you’re building on acreage, customizing heavily, or trying to balance style with practicality.

Key advantages include:

1. One Team, One Process – You’re not caught between separate contractors and designers. Everyone is working toward the same goal.

2. Clearer Budget Control – Design choices and budget realities are considered together, which helps prevent costly redesigns later.

3. Faster Problem Solving – When questions come up (and they will), they get answered quickly because the team is aligned.

4. Better Communication – Fewer handoffs means fewer misunderstandings and fewer gaps in expectations.

5. More Efficient Timeline – Planning and scheduling are streamlined, which often reduces delays compared to traditional approaches.

6. Design That Matches Real Life – Layout decisions are based on how you’ll actually live and use the space, not just how it looks on paper.

Whether your project is a custom home, a barndominium, or a farm building, design/build helps you move forward with confidence.
